# ISO Standards Compliance Documentation
## Overview
This document specifies the exact ISO standards that NoDupeLabs adheres to for source code archival and documentation.
## ISO Standards for Source Code
### 1. SPDX (ISO/IEC 5962:2021)
**Standard:** SPDX (Software Package Data Exchange) - ISO/IEC 5962:2021
**Purpose:** International standard for communicating software bill of materials (SBOM) information.
**Implementation:**
- All source files contain SPDX-License-Identifier header
- License: Apache-2.0
**Example:**
```python
# SPDX-License-Identifier: Apache-2.0
# Copyright (c) 2025 Allaun
```
**Files Compliant:** 16 database modules + all project source files
### 2. PEP 8 (Style Guide for Python Code)
**Standard:** PEP 8 - Style Guide for Python Code
**Purpose:** Coding conventions for the Python programming language.
**Implementation:**
- 4-space indentation
- Maximum line length: 100 characters
- Proper naming conventions (snake_case for functions/variables, PascalCase for classes)
- Two blank lines between top-level definitions
### 3. PEP 257 (Docstring Conventions)
**Standard:** PEP 257 - Docstring Conventions
**Purpose:** Conventions for Python docstrings.
**Implementation:**
- All modules have module-level docstrings
- All classes have class docstrings with:
- Summary line (imperative mood)
- Extended description (if needed)
- Attributes section
- Example section
- All public methods have docstrings with:
- Summary line
- Args section
- Returns section
- Raises section
- Example section

### 2. ACID Properties (ISO/IEC/IEC 25010)
**Standard:** ISO/IEC 25010:2011 - Systems and software engineering
**Purpose:** Database operations guarantee ACID properties:
- **Atomicity**: Transactions are all-or-nothing
- **Consistency**: Database moves from one valid state to another
- **Isolation**: Concurrent transactions appear serial
- **Durability**: Committed data is permanent
### 3. Connection Standards
**Implementation:**
- Thread-safe connection handling using `threading.local()`
- Connection pooling via singleton pattern
- WAL (Write-Ahead Logging) mode for concurrent access
